[Remote] FEMA-Disaster Recovery Specialists (Civil Engineers)

Remote Full-time
Note: The job is a remote job and is open to candidates in USA. Dewberry is a leading professional services firm seeking Civil Engineers to support disaster recovery efforts across the United States. The role involves deploying to disaster sites to assist FEMA and local governments in delivering disaster recovery programs, including preparing grant applications and assessing damaged infrastructure. Responsibilities • Deploy to disaster sites to support FEMA or other government entities in the delivery of disaster recovery programs such as the Public Assistance (PA) program or the FEMA Individual Assistance (IA) Direct Housing program • Assist FEMA, local government agencies and other program-eligible entities in the preparation of grant applications for the restoration of damaged public infrastructure such as roads, bridges, buildings and utilities • Plan and develop temporary housing solutions for disaster survivors • Conduct site assessments of disaster-damaged infrastructure • Document detailed damage descriptions • Develop restoration or new facility scopes of work • Formulate detailed cost estimates • Assist with hazard mitigation planning Skills • Bachelor's degree in civil engineering or related field from an accredited university • Minimum of 5 years of full-time professional experience working with public infrastructure • Knowledge of modern construction practices and experience conducting facility assessments, performing construction inspection, and developing project scope and cost estimates • Working knowledge of International Building Code (IBC),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A), and other governmental regulatory compliance • Excellent oral and written communication skills • Must be computer literate and proficient with Microsoft Office applications • Must be able to work both independently and in a team environment under stressful conditions • The ability to work up to 12 hours per day, 7 days a week while deployed to a disaster recovery operation for up to 12 months • Must have a valid driver's license and clean driving record • Be a U.S. citizen capable of passing a federal background investigation to obtain a Public Trust clearance • Licensed Professional Engineer • Working knowledge of the FEMA PA Program law, regulation and policy • Prior FEMA PA experience as: Program Delivery Manager, Site Inspector, Policy Advisor, Cost Estimator, or Hazard Mitigation Specialist • Working knowledge of FEMA's Grants Manager or Grants Portal • Experience with residential site development or construction including roads, utilities, and drainage • Proficiency using cost estimating software such as RS Means and Xactimate Company Overview • Leading, market-facing firm with a proven history of providing professional services to a wide variety of public & private-sector clients.
